Re: Sighting in

Bill is spot on. Normally if you sight in with a 39 or 40gr bullet, and then shoot the 32's, your poi will be higher than with the 40's. Re: Bore solvent

For the carbon, I use a mix of Shooters Choice, 65 to 70% and Kroil, 30 to 35%. It does a really god job on the carbon and powder fouling.
